Alfa Romeo: the Canadian Minister Calls Marchionne to build in Canada

The meeting between Sergio Marchionne, the Minister of Economic Development Ontario in Canada, Sandra Pupatello Canadian Ambassador James Fox has spoken of the assembly of Alfa Romeo. In particular, we discussed the possibility of assembling cars Alfa Romeo in the Canadian establishments. Doing so may increase the production of the Alfa but at the same time there would be more jobs in Canada.

Produces Chrysler Canada plant in Brampton, the 300C and the Dodge Challenger, while the minivan plant in Windsor and the Town & Country. Canada may be an attractive market for Fiat because even there the market demand for small cars is increasing. In this summit to Fiat was given the proximity to the United States, tax benefits, at a rate of 25% for business, but also by more than 60% deduction for investments in research and development.
